Create a repeating region in a template

Repeating regions enable template users to duplicate a specified region in a template as often as desired. A repeating region is not necessarily an editable region.

To make content in a repeating region editable (for example, to allow a user to enter text in a table cell in a template-based document), you must insert an editable region in the repeating region.

  1. In the Document window, do one of the following:
    • Select the text or content you want to set as a repeating region.

    • Place the insertion point in the document where you want to insert the repeating region.

  2. Do one of the following:
    • Select Insert > Template Objects > Repeating Region.

    • Right-click (Windows) or Control‑click (Macintosh), then select Templates > New Repeating Region.

    • In the Common category of the Insert bar, click the Templates button, then select Repeating Region from the pop-up menu.

  3. In the Name box, enter a unique name for the template region. (You cannot use the same name for more than one repeating region in a template.)
    Note: When you name a region, do not use special characters.
  4. Click OK.
